F213SAInformation about inequalities

(1)

NHS England must publish a statement setting out—

(a)

a description of the powers available to relevant NHS bodies to collect, analyse and publish information relating to—

(i)

inequalities between persons with respect to their ability to access health services;

(ii)

inequalities between persons with respect to the outcomes achieved for them by the provision of health services (including the outcomes described in section 13E(3)); and

(b)

the views of NHS England about how those powers should be exercised in connection with such information.

(2)

NHS England may from time to time publish a revised statement under subsection (1).

(3)

In this section “relevant NHS bodies” means—

(a)

integrated care boards,

(b)

NHS trusts established under section 25, and

(c)

NHS foundation trusts.
